- P70S6 KINASE MODULATORS AND METHOD OF USE
-
The invention provides compounds and methods for inhibition of kinases, more specifically p70S6 kinases. The invention provides compounds for modulating protein kinase enzymatic activity for modulating cellular activities such as proliferation, differentiation, programmed cell death, migration, chemoinvasion and metabolism. Compounds of the invention inhibit, regulate and/or modulate kinase receptor signal transduction pathways related to the changes in cellular activities as mentioned above, and the invention includes compositions which contain these compounds, and methods of using them to treat kinase-dependent diseases and conditions.

- CYCLIZATION OF NITRILES. XXIV. REACTIONS OF CYANAMIDE DERIVATIVES OF THIOCARBAMIC ACIDS WITH CYANOTHIOACETAMIDE. CRYSTAL STRUCTURE OF 2-ALLYLAMINO-4-AMINO-5-BENZOYL-1,3-THIAZOLE
-
2-Allylamino-4-amino-5-aroyl-1,3-thiazoles were obtained from S-alkylisoureas.An x-ray crystallographic investigation of 2-allylamino-4-amino-5-benzoyl-1,3-thiazole was undertaken.Dimethyl dithiocarbamate was used in the synthesis of 2-amino-4-methylthio-5-cyano-1H-pyrimidine-6-thione and, from the latter, 4-allylthio-2-amino-6-methylthio-5-cyanopyrimidine.The latter is easily quaternized by the action of iodine to 4-amino-3-iodomethyl-7-methylthio-8-cyano-2,3-dihydrothiazolopyrimidinium triiodide.In reaction with iodine 2-allylamino-1,3-thiazoles form N-allyl-N-iodo derivatives of 1,3-thiazole and not imidazothiazolium salts.
